MORTALITY AMONG BIG LAMBS.

Writing in the "Farmers' Union Advocate," "Agricola," the South Island contributor of that journal, says :— The Sheepowners' Union has discussed the matter of the mortality among the big lambs, and an effort is being made to get the Agricultural Department, in conjunction, with the various farmors' organisations, to. make a thorough investigation. According to some of the members the deaths among these lambs have assumed big proportions, and farmers are alarmed. It is a matter that affects the farmers most because the lambs on the higher country where there is little else but tussock are not affected. Ail sort£ of theories are advanced for the trouble. Some think that the frosty weather has had something tc do with it. Others say that they believe that the youngsters are too well fed, while yet others consider that they have not been getting the exercise that they should take. Investigations should have been made when the trouble was at its wors.t. The deaths are not so numerous now, and it may be more difficult to get cases to examine. The main portion of that work will have to be left till next season probably, but in the meantime farmers could be asked to give their experiences in connection with the deaths. They could state the circumstances under which the sheep were kept and anything that cam© undep their notice in dealing with the sheep and the lambs after the mortality had commenced. Some good might. be done by comparing notes received in this way and a good deal of general Information procured.
